If it's the "navicular", a peanut shaped bone at the base of the thumb, I know what you're going through.  I broke mine 12 years ago next month and was incredulous when the first doc I saw said I need a "thumb-spica" cast for 6 weeks and then another shorter cast for another 6 weeks.  It's no joke - if that bone doesn't heal properly you'll be disabled to some extent.  Take care of it, Jim, and get it well for GS6.
